Block Energy, Utility PNM Collaborating on Residential Microgrid in New Mexico

PNM will own and operate the microgrid, including the solar panels, battery storage and control system in a long-term plan. Customers connected to the grid and microgrid will ...

N.S. news: province to spend $15M on arts, community projects

The Nova Scotia government is spending more than $15 million on 11 arts and community projects around the province, including a new community centre in Oxford and upgrades to Neptune Theatre in Halifax.

Curtain call at Neptune Theatre as general manager bids adieu

Lisa Bugden helmed the theatre for six years and steered it through a pandemic. Now she’s leaving to run her own flower shop.

Lets Walk the Talk launches mental health podcast; Paul Laberge preps for 2021 Walk

Paul Laberge crosses the finish line after a 6-day walk from Saskatoon to Lloydminster for Let's Walk the Talk 2019. (106.1 The Goat)
Paul Laberge is hoping to keep the talk about mental health going as many people, including himself, face challenges due to things like the COVID-19 pandemic.
Last year and the beginning of 2021 saw several changes for his mental health initiatives through his organization
Let’s Walk the Talk. Due to the COVID-19 pandemic, Laberge has had to put a lot of events on hold or change them.

Lloydminster's Gift to Health surpasses fundraising goal by over $100,000

Lloydminster's Gift to Health, hosted by Shaun Newman, surpassed its fundraising goals. (Lloydminster Region Health Foundation, Facebook)
Lloydminster residents and businesses came together to show their love and care for seniors and members of the community who are in need of care at the hospital.
Lloydminster’s Gift to Health, a 12 hour radiothon organized by the Lloydminster Region Health Foundation, aimed to raise $200,000 to help connect seniors and people in the hospital with their loved ones and surpassed that goal by over $100,000.
Donations made during the event goes towards tablets and phones to help seniors and their families stay in touch, portable oxygen machines, lab equipment, defibrillators for the hospital and other care equipment such as blanket and towel warmers and ice machines used to aid with swelling.
